He is known for his starring roles in the NBC military drama series Baa Baa Black Sheep (19761978), the NBC sitcom Night Court (19841992; 2023present) for which he received four consecutive Primetime Emmy Awards for Outstanding Supporting Actor in a Comedy Series during the earlier incarnation, the NBC sitcom The John Larroquette Show (19931996), the David E. Kelley legal drama series The Practice (19972002), the ABC legal comedy-drama series Boston Legal (20042008), and the TNT series The Librarians (20142018).
